The "Middle Āgama Sutras" belong to the Chinese translations of the Āgama collection and preserve mid-length early Buddhist discourses on topics including practice, ethics, concentration and wisdom, liberation, and monastic life. The "Middle Āgama Sutras" correspond in literary type to the Pali Majjhima Nikaya, containing mid-length Buddhist discourses. Their contents are largely composed of the Buddha and disciples’ questions and answers, admonitions, and instructions on practice, making them important material for the study of early Buddhist doctrine, meditation, ethics, and monastic regulations.
